So I was playing a game on Windows 10 and it freezes and blue screens so my PC just decides to make my gtx 980 stop working (as said in device manager) so I install Windows 7 on a new ssd of mine and it still will not detect my gtx 980. So I take out my 980, and put in my 750 ti in the completely different pci express slot, and it won't even recognize my 750. I've updated Windows to the fullest, tried switching main graphics in bios, but it still will not detect my graphics card at all, not even in device manager.
I know this isn't a dead card because the fans still spin up and it worked fine the last time I used it, before I took it out.

i would try rolling back to a previous System Restore state from before the issue. if that doesn't help or is not available try Windows 10's upgrade/repair option. running the install media from within Windows and choosing to keep your existing files & settings will replace OS shell data and fix most problems related to Windows.
if neither of those options helps I would consider replacing or returning the graphics card.
